Tokyo Vice: An American Reporter on the Police Beat in Japan by Jake Adelstein

4.0

(4.5) A fascinating look at the life of a gaijin reporter on the crime beat in Japan. It's interesting to note that underneath the cultural differences between Japan and the US, the similar motifs of crime still lurk. Adelstein does as deep of a dive as one could expect and the results are interesting. Some will read this as a tourist-y read, which I think is wrong. Japan is far more than just crime culture filtered through the lens of a foreigner. But if you want to know about the Japanese underworld and its idiosyncrasies, check this out.
